TriCo Bancshares (TCBK) reported first‑quarter 2026 earnings per share of $1.04, sur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.9879 by 5.27%. Revenue figures were not disclosed. The stock reacted positively, rising 1.03% in after‑hours trading, as investors focused on the earnings beat amid a still‑challenging interest‑rate environment.
